fre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于嵌入式linux的圖像監(jiān)控系統(tǒng)-資料下載頁

2025-06-27 20:13本頁面
  

【正文】 過網(wǎng)絡(luò)連接后臺服務(wù)器,前臺和后臺握手后建立連接,并接收圖像數(shù)據(jù),實時顯示圖像和視頻。Socket是TCP/IP協(xié)議傳輸層所提供的接口(稱為套接口),供用戶編程訪問網(wǎng)絡(luò)資源[8]。流式套接字提供了一套可靠的面向連接的數(shù)據(jù)傳輸方法,流式套接字需要由socket()函數(shù)來創(chuàng)建[9],而調(diào)用時必須要用bind()函數(shù)為它分配一個地址。圖52是基于本系統(tǒng)的簡單流式套接字的示意圖。錯誤!鏈接無效。圖52 流式套接字的示意圖在圖52 流式套接字的示意圖中,服務(wù)器創(chuàng)建好套接字,并且賦給其一個地址之后,使用listen()函數(shù)來偵聽客戶端的連接請求,如果連接成功就調(diào)用accept()函數(shù)返回一個新的套接字描述符來處理雙方的通信過程??蛻舳藶榱送ㄖ?wù)器端接收其發(fā)出的連接請求,也必須先建立一個Socket,接著調(diào)用connect()函數(shù)來發(fā)送連接請求。雙方結(jié)束通信后,都要調(diào)用close()函數(shù)來結(jié)束Socket通信。 圖像采集后的傳輸算法舉例(1)本系統(tǒng)在基于TCP/IP協(xié)議基礎(chǔ)下采用mjpg (即mjpeg)協(xié)議。它的原理是把視頻鏡頭拍成的視頻分解成一張張分離的jpg數(shù)據(jù)發(fā)送到客戶端。當(dāng)客戶端不斷顯示圖片,即可形成相應(yīng)的圖像。mjpg協(xié)議流程如下:①mjpg在的mime type是“xmixedreplace”。但mjpg首先是要由客戶發(fā)一個GET取一個特殊文件(不同攝像頭有不同的定義,系統(tǒng)針對不同的攝像頭定義了不同的文件)。②如果ipcam返回200,表示已經(jīng)接收的請求,并在返回的頭里指明邊界字符串,這是在context type的boundary子屬性來指明的。③然后ipcam開始發(fā)送JPG數(shù)據(jù),首先是發(fā)送類型和長度。ContentType= image/jpeg以及用ContentLength指向隨后的長度。④當(dāng)一個圖發(fā)送完畢后,以邊界字符串來結(jié)束。(2)在本監(jiān)控系統(tǒng)中,我們使用了mjpgstreamer, mjpgstreamer是常用來實現(xiàn)mjpg流傳輸?shù)拈_源項目,我們通俗的介紹一下它的協(xié)議內(nèi)容來舉例本系統(tǒng)圖像傳輸?shù)乃惴?。①首先是發(fā)送 GET /?action=stream\n\n②服務(wù)器響應(yīng)200表示聯(lián)接成功。并指明是multipart/xmixedreplace的mjpg數(shù)據(jù),邊界字符串是boundarydonotcrossHTTP/ 200 OK //傳輸協(xié)議Connection: close Server: MJPGStreamer/ CacheControl: nostore, nocache, mustrevalidate, precheck=0, postcheck=0, maxage=0Pragma: nocacheExpires: Mon, 3 Jan 2000 12:34:56 GMTContentType: multipart/xmixedreplace。boundary=boundarydonotcrossboundarydonotcross //邊界字符串③接下是開始發(fā)送JPG數(shù)據(jù)ContentType: image/jpegContentLength: 19454《中間19454字節(jié)就是一個JPG完整的圖像》④—boundarydonotcross //一個圖發(fā)送完畢后,以邊界字符串來結(jié)束⑤當(dāng)連續(xù)不斷發(fā)送這個數(shù)據(jù),在客戶端即可顯示視頻 本章小結(jié)本章主要闡述了監(jiān)控系統(tǒng)的圖像采集和傳輸?shù)膶崿F(xiàn)。圖像采集部分介紹了系統(tǒng)圖像采集的過程,并深入舉例分析了實現(xiàn)系統(tǒng)算法的關(guān)鍵函數(shù);最后描述實現(xiàn)監(jiān)控系統(tǒng)的網(wǎng)絡(luò)傳輸和圖像采集后的傳輸算法舉例,以求達到遠程監(jiān)控圖像視頻的目的。6 系統(tǒng)測試(1)通過瀏覽器監(jiān)控步驟:①連接好硬件:系統(tǒng)接好5V電源,接好網(wǎng)線、串口線,插裝好USB攝像頭。②啟動mjpgstreamer,在串口終端執(zhí)行: cd /mipgstreamer ./能在終端觀察到如下信息,則說明已經(jīng)成功啟動mjpgstreamer。 MJPG Streamer Version.: i: Using V4L2 device.: /dev/video0 i: Desired Resolution.: 640x480 i: Frames Per Second.: 5 i: Format............: MJPEG o: folderpath...: .// o: HTTP TCP port.....: 8080 o: username:password.: disabled o: mands..........: enabled③通過瀏覽器動態(tài)瀏覽USB攝像頭:在瀏覽器中輸入::8080/。④通過瀏覽器動態(tài)瀏覽USB攝像頭:在瀏覽器中輸入::8080/,如附錄圖1所示。 ⑤換另外的攝像頭,重新上述操作進行系統(tǒng)測試。測試結(jié)果如表1所示。 ⑥分別用不同的瀏覽器進行登錄,如IE,F(xiàn)irefox,360瀏覽器,遨游瀏覽器等進行測試。測試結(jié)果如表2所示。表1 攝像頭測試表CLASSICT06霸王眼√ANC酷吧吸盤版05OTA√表2 瀏覽器支持測試表√√360瀏覽器√遨游瀏覽器√ ⑦在分辨率為640x480的情況下,T06霸王眼幀率大概為每秒11幀,ANC05OTA幀率大概為每秒9幀。測試多個用戶使用客戶端同時進行監(jiān)控,可以觀察到,幀率基本穩(wěn)定。測試結(jié)果表明,系統(tǒng)基本上達到了課題預(yù)定的目標(biāo),實現(xiàn)了圖像和視頻監(jiān)控的功能。7 總結(jié)和展望自選題以來,圍繞嵌入式處理器選型、嵌入式系統(tǒng)硬件設(shè)計、linux系統(tǒng)移植和Linux系統(tǒng)設(shè)備啟動、Linux下視頻采集和網(wǎng)絡(luò)傳輸?shù)燃夹g(shù)進行了一定的研究和實驗。最終確定了本方案并基本實現(xiàn)目標(biāo)?,F(xiàn)對全文總結(jié)如下:本論文討論了基于嵌入式Linux的圖像監(jiān)控系統(tǒng)的設(shè)計方法,基本完成了網(wǎng)絡(luò)圖像視頻監(jiān)控系統(tǒng)的設(shè)計,主要工作包括系統(tǒng)總體設(shè)計、硬件和linux系統(tǒng)平臺的建立、系統(tǒng)設(shè)備的驅(qū)動程序的編寫和移植以及系統(tǒng)的圖像采集和傳輸。由于時間限制,本系統(tǒng)仍需進一步完善。對于嵌入式監(jiān)控系統(tǒng)的研究,還有很多的問題需進一步探討。認(rèn)為有以下幾個方面需要改進:(1)可以加入智能控制的監(jiān)控方法,設(shè)計算法并編寫算法代碼,如運動物體檢測、行為識別、人臉識別等。實現(xiàn)真正的無人智能監(jiān)控。(2)可擴展DSP芯片進行視頻編解碼,利用其高效的編解碼能力提高視頻監(jiān)控時實時性。(3)可通過日益發(fā)展的無線網(wǎng)絡(luò)進行傳輸圖像視頻數(shù)據(jù),在手機、PDA等網(wǎng)絡(luò)終端上進行對攝像頭監(jiān)控。(4)增加遠程對攝像頭的云臺控制,使其更符合監(jiān)控的要求。19賀州學(xué)院本科畢業(yè)論文參考文獻[1]韋東山. 嵌入式linux開發(fā)完全手冊[M]. 北京:人民郵電出版社. [2]宋寶華. Linux設(shè)備驅(qū)動開發(fā)詳解[M]. 北京:人民郵電出版社. [3]任橋偉. linux內(nèi)核修煉之道[M]. 北京:人民郵電出版社. [4]河秦,王洪濤. [M]. 北京:人民郵電出版社. [5]廣州友善之臂公司. mini2440用戶手冊[EB/OL]. 廣州:[6]丁林松,黃麗琴. Qt4圖形設(shè)計與嵌入式開發(fā)[M]. 北京:人民郵電出版社. 200904[7]宋敬彬,孫海濱. Linux網(wǎng)絡(luò)編程[M]. 北京:清華大學(xué)出版社. 201001[8]華清遠見. 嵌入式linux系統(tǒng)開發(fā)標(biāo)準(zhǔn)教程[M]. 北京:人民郵電出版社. 附 錄圖1 系統(tǒng)客戶端監(jiān)控主頁圖21賀州學(xué)院本科畢業(yè)論文致 謝首先感謝我的導(dǎo)師曾繁政老師。曾老師活躍的思維、嚴(yán)謹(jǐn)?shù)闹螌W(xué)精神、精益求精的工作作風(fēng)讓我受用一生。從專業(yè)課的學(xué)習(xí)、電賽的參與和畢業(yè)論文的設(shè)計,曾老師對我提出了許多指導(dǎo)性的意見和建議,傾注了大量的心血。正是在曾老師科學(xué)、嚴(yán)謹(jǐn)?shù)闹笇?dǎo)下,我的畢業(yè)論文才得以完成。曾老師不僅在專業(yè)學(xué)習(xí)上對我嚴(yán)格要求,而且在日常工作和生活中也給與我非常多的幫助和意見,教會我正確的做人做事的態(tài)度。這也激勵我在今后的學(xué)習(xí)、工作和生活中,時刻保持勤奮踏實的工作態(tài)度和求實創(chuàng)新的上進精神。再次,向我的導(dǎo)師曾繁政老師,表示深深的敬意和感謝!接著感謝賀州學(xué)院物電系各位老師五年來的教導(dǎo),你們的教導(dǎo)是我在人生的道路上受益匪淺。同時感謝學(xué)院為我們提供了物電系大學(xué)生創(chuàng)新基地這么好的平臺。同時感謝在基地里的同學(xué)們,甚至是小師弟小師妹們,謝謝你們對我一直以來的關(guān)心和幫助,有你們的陪伴讓我大學(xué)生活充實而精彩。最后,謹(jǐn)以此文獻給我最摯愛的家人,謝謝家人一直以來的辛勞養(yǎng)育和默
點擊復(fù)制文檔內(nèi)容
職業(yè)教育相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1